On 7/23/20 the Office of Head Start posted grant opportunity HHS-2020-ACF-OHS-HP-1852 for Early Head Start Expansion and Early Head Start-Child Care Partnership Grants with funding of $103.1 million.
The grant will be issued under grant program 93.600 Head Start.
It is expected that 60 total grants will be made
worth between $750,000 and $21.1 million.

Additional Info
Eligible applicants are any public or private non-profit agencies, including community-based and faith-based organizations, or for-profit agencies pursuant to Section 645A(d) of the Head Start Act, 42 U.S.C. § 9840A(d).
Entities operating Head Start programs are eligible to operate Early Head Start programs. Faith-based and community organizations that meet the eligibility requirements are eligible to receive awards under this funding opportunity announcement. Applications from individuals (including sole proprietorships) and foreign entities are not eligible and will be disqualified from competitive review and from funding under this announcement.
